533851025803 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 533851025804. Its totient is φ = 533851025802.

The previous prime is 533851025791. The next prime is 533851025819. The reversal of 533851025803 is 308520158335.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 533851025803 - 213 = 533851017611 is a prime.

It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 533851025803.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(533851005803)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 266925512901 + 266925512902.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(266925512902).

Almost surely, 2533851025803 is an apocalyptic number.

533851025803 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

533851025803 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

533851025803 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 432000, while the sum is 43.
